declare const _default: import("vue").DefineComponent<{ rootStyle: import("vue").PropType; rootClass: StringConstructor; modelValue: StringConstructor; length: { type: NumberConstructor; default: number; }; type: { type: import("vue").PropType>; default: string; }; gap: (StringConstructor | NumberConstructor)[]; plainText: BooleanConstructor; focused: BooleanConstructor; customKeyboard: BooleanConstructor; disabled: BooleanConstructor; readonly: BooleanConstructor; validateEvent: { type: BooleanConstructor; default: boolean; }; }, {}, unknown, {}, {}, import("vue").ComponentOptionsMixin, import("vue").ComponentOptionsMixin, { "update:model-value": (...args: any[]) => void; "updat:focused": (...args: any[]) => void; }, string, import("vue").VNodeProps & import("vue").AllowedComponentProps & import("vue").ComponentCustomProps, Readonly; rootClass: StringConstructor; modelValue: StringConstructor; length: { type: NumberConstructor; default: number; }; type: { type: import("vue").PropType>; default: string; }; gap: (StringConstructor | NumberConstructor)[]; plainText: BooleanConstructor; focused: BooleanConstructor; customKeyboard: BooleanConstructor; disabled: BooleanConstructor; readonly: BooleanConstructor; validateEvent: { type: BooleanConstructor; default: boolean; }; }>> & { "onUpdate:model-value"?: ((...args: any[]) => any) | undefined; "onUpdat:focused"?: ((...args: any[]) => any) | undefined; }, { length: number; type: NonNullable<"border" | "underline" | undefined>; validateEvent: boolean; disabled: boolean; readonly: boolean; focused: boolean; plainText: boolean; customKeyboard: boolean; }, {}>; export default _default;